The dragon boat festival is a celebration where many drink realgar wines (xiong huangjiu), eat rice dumplings (zongzi), take long walks, hang mugwort and calamus, wear perfumed medicine bags, and write spells. Dragon boat festival, also called duanwu festival, is one of the four grandest traditional festivals in china, falling on 5th day of the 5th month in chinese lunar calendar.
